GNet8.1微波规划GIS设计与核心算法探讨
175 浏览量
更新于2024-06-23
收藏 2.48MB DOC 举报
"基于GNet8.1的微波规划GIS设计与核心算法研究"
本文深入探讨了基于GNet8.1平台的微波规划地理信息系统(GIS)的设计与实现,着重于关键算法的研究。在微波通信网络规划中,GIS扮演着至关重要的角色,它能够整合地理数据、实地条件和其他GIS技术,以支持网络设计和优化。
首先,文章详细阐述了项目的需求分析,明确了项目目标,定义了项目背景和边界条件,包括所涉及的约束和设计原则。此外,讨论了开发环境的配置,如编程语言、开发工具和操作系统,以及项目所需的接口列表,以便与其他系统或应用程序集成。项目的时间表也被详细规划,列出了各个关键里程碑的预计完成时间。
在架构设计层面,项目采用四层架构,包括框架层、公共库、应用层和组件层。框架层作为基础,提供通用的服务和接口;公共库包含了可复用的代码和模块,提高开发效率;应用层专注于具体功能实现,如微波路径规划和优化;组件层则包含独立的功能单元,如数据处理和可视化组件。
在功能实现部分,文章重点讨论了几个关键技术点:栅格数据解析,这涉及到将栅格数据转化为可操作的信息;地图坐标的转换,确保不同地图投影之间的准确转换;地形纹理地图的生成,利用遥感数据创建逼真的地形表现;以及DEM(数字高程模型)数据的检索,用于模拟地形特征和计算路径损失。为提高性能,项目还引入了如栅格金字塔(用于快速缩放和浏览)、数据缓冲区(优化数据加载速度)和预制颜色表(简化颜色映射)等优化策略。
在项目收尾阶段,进行了全面的质量评估,包括整体质量、各维度质量评价以及缺陷分析。结果表明,该软件成功满足了合作伙伴RTN Designer的预期需求,证明了基于GNet8.1平台的GIS设计和核心算法的有效性。
关键词:GIS设计,栅格解析,坐标转换,地形地图,DEM检索,微波规划,项目管理,软件架构,性能优化
点击了解资源详情
2021-05-25 上传
2021-10-03 上传
2022-06-04 上传
2021-10-06 上传
2021-05-27 上传
2021-10-07 上传
matlab大师
- 粉丝: 2736
- 资源: 8万+
最新资源
- Angular实现MarcHayek简历展示应用教程
- Crossbow Spot最新更新 - 获取Chrome扩展新闻
- 量子管道网络优化与Python实现
- Debian系统中APT缓存维护工具的使用方法与实践
- Python模块AccessControl的Windows64位安装文件介绍
- 掌握最新*** Fisher资讯,使用Google Chrome扩展
- Ember应用程序开发流程与环境配置指南
- EZPCOpenSDK_v5.1.2_build***版本更新详情
- Postcode-Finder:利用JavaScript和Google Geocode API实现
- AWS商业交易监控器:航线行为分析与营销策略制定
- AccessControl-4.0b6压缩包详细使用教程
- Python编程实践与技巧汇总
- 使用Sikuli和Python打造颜色求解器项目
- .Net基础视频教程:掌握GDI绘图技术
- 深入理解数据结构与JavaScript实践项目
- 双子座在线裁判系统:提高编程竞赛效率